Standard Dressing Versus Moist Dressing in the Course of the Postoperative Wound in Patients With Knee Prosthesis

NCT04422119 · Status: UNKNOWN · Phase: NA · Type: INTERVENTIONAL · Enrollment: 150

Last updated 2020-06-09

No results posted yet for this study

Summary

The aim of the study is: to evaluate the efficacy of two post-operative dressings in the management of the surgical wounds in patients who received a knee prosthesis

Conditions

  • Surgical Wound
  • Knee Disease

Interventions

PROCEDURE

Multi-Foam dressing

Application of a multi-layer foam dressing with Safetac in surgical wound

PROCEDURE

Usual care

Care of surgical wound with povidone-iodine and a gauze dressing with plaster.
